Meaning of Naznin
Naznin originates from the Persian language, combining the word ‘naz’ (ناز) meaning ‘delicacy’, ‘grace’, or ‘coquettish charm’ with the feminine suffix ‘-nin’. The complete meaning translates to ‘delicate one’, ‘graceful lady’, or ‘tender woman’. In Persian and Urdu literary traditions, ‘naz’ represents a specific type of elegant, subtle beauty that is both alluring and refined. The name appears in classical Persian poetry and was popularized in South Asia through the influence of Persian culture during the Mughal Empire. Unlike many names that have multiple possible origins, Naznin has a clear and well-documented Persian etymology.

Origin & Cultural Significance
Naznin emerged from classical Persian literature and culture, where it was used as both a given name and a poetic term for a graceful woman. The name spread throughout the Muslim world via Persian cultural influence, particularly in regions like Afghanistan, Pakistan, India, and Iran. During the Mughal era (1526-1857), Persian was the court language of the Indian subcontinent, leading to the adoption of many Persian names like Naznin into Muslim naming traditions. Today, the name remains popular among Persian-speaking communities and South Asian Muslims who appreciate its literary heritage and elegant meaning.

Famous People Named Naznin
- Nazneen Contractor — Canadian actress of Indian descent known for roles in '24' and 'The Border'
- Nazneen Rahman — British geneticist and cancer researcher, Professor at The Institute of Cancer Research
